Grading policy

Your grade will depend upon three in-class tests with the following dates; Tests will be administered during lab periods.

Homework (assigned daily and graded as 0, + or -), and quizzes (10-minute duration, given during lab periods) are designed to provide feedback. They can affect your grade only in a nonnegative fashion. There is a positive correlation between the amount of homework completed and success in the course.

The final exam will be given in the scheduled period during finals week. As per math department policy, you will be given 3 hours for the final exam.
